Adele has apologized after a fan was hurt at one of her concerts in Scotland on Friday.
The incident reportedly happened Friday night at the SSE Hydro venue in Glasgow, when a chain fell from production rigging and hit a woman in the audience.
The woman was treated at the scene and hospitalized as a precaution.
“I’m so sorry to hear that someone got hurt at my show tonight. It’s being investigated to ensure it won’t happen again,” the singer tweeted later that night.
Officials say the venue is being checked to make sure it’s safe for Adele’s future shows.
